WebA palpable mass (white arrow) in the right breast has a partly circumscribed and partly (>25%) obscured margin on the full CC (A) view. However, the CC (B) spot compression view improves the visualization of the margins of the mass, which are entirely circumscribed with additional compression. WebIn particular, multiple bilateral circumscribed masses (MBCM) as defined by three or more masses in total with at least one in each breast, are typically deemed benign on mammography and have a 0% (95% CI, 0–2.4%) likelihood of malignancy on US based on data in high-risk women [2, 3]. WebCystic lesions of the breast may present in women of any age but are most common between 30 and 50 years of age ( Table 1 ). They may be detected incidentally on screening mammography or present with such signs and symptoms as nipple discharge or a palpable mass. WebThe woman was lost to follow-up before surgery, and 10 months later, she returned with a palpable mass in the right breast. Mammogram showed an oval mass with circumscribed margins (a–b). Ultrasound images demonstrated a sizeable oval mass with a parallel orientation, circumscribed margins, and absent posterior acoustic findings (c). WebBy multiple bilateral masses, we mean at least three masses, with at least one mass in each breast. To be considered partially circumscribed, at least 75% of the margins of a mass should be circumscribed, with the remaining margins obscured by adjacent fibroglandular tissue. No part of the margins may be indistinct or spiculated.

In its mixed form, the ultrasound appearance depends on the percentage of invasive ductal carcinoma, giving it an angular, spiculated, non-circumscribed margin and posterior attenuation [26], [27], [28].

WebJun 23, 2024 · Based on sonographic Breast Imaging Reporting and Data System (BI-RADS), suspicious appearing descriptors such as spiculated margin, irregularity, and non-parallel orientation have high predictive value for malignant tumors.
